M537 KRU is a 1994 Suzuki GSF400 in Black with a 398c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 70%.
Across all 1994 Suzuki GSF400 models, the average MOT pass rate is 80.3% with a typical mileage of 23,220 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Suzuki GSF400 fails its MOT is shock absorber seal failed and leaking oil, accounting for 156 recorded failures. If you're considering buying M537 KRU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Suzuki GSF400 typically stays on UK roads for around 37 years. At 32 years old, this Suzuki GSF400 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
